IN THE HIGH COURT OF KERALA AT ERNAKULAM
MOHAMMED NIAS C.P., J
IRFAN – Appellant
Versus
THE SUPERINTENDENT OF POLICE, KOLLAM RURAL – Respondent

JUDGMENT

The petitioner is aggrieved as the 4th respondent has not considered his request for a Police Clearance Certificate (PCC) favourably.

2. The learned DSGI appearing for the 4th respondent would submit that the petitioner is involved in a criminal case and therefore, only a Customised PCC can be issued, and that too only on orders from this Court.

3. Having he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ned DSGI appearing for the 4th respondent and having perused Ext.P2 order of the Assistant Sessions Court, Kollam, this writ petition is disposed of directing the 4th respondent to issue a Customized PCC to the petitioner also mentioning the details of the case mentioned in Ext.P2 order. The needful shall be done within two weeks from the date of receipt of a certified copy of this judgment.

The writ petition is disposed of as above.
